stall insulin test. thoughts on efficacy?

LJ Friedman

Eleanor Kellon, VMD


There's no solid information on the site or anywhere else I could find. Wrote and asked for details.
Eleanor in PA 
EC Owner 2001

Sherry Morse

When this was first asked about many months ago I had also requested information about it and got no response so I'm not holding my breath on anything other than a slick website and marketing campaign from these folks.